I thought Q would be difficult. Imagine my luck when “Quinn the Eskimo” was stuck in my head. I hadn’t heard it for quite awhile. There are a few covers. Manfred Mann does a fairly popular version but someone renamed it “Mighty Quinn.” It was written by Bob Dylan. I read somewhere that he originally recorded it with The Band as the band. Can you imagine having The Band as your back up? And I’ve also heard that people booed Bob Dylan and the Band because Dylan went electric. Also unimaginable that people would boo. I guess the audience thought he was selling out. All I can say is . . . whatever. I’d be happy to hear Dylan play acoustic, electric, folk, rock, gospel, chamber music. . . whatever.
